Does anyone know of better weather stripping for ttops for C3 (72) vette? Or know a thread that talks about how to adjust them so water doesn't pour inside the cabin? Thanx in advance. PS.. I had new weather stripping put on last year, but don't know which brand was bought.
Wow. Never heard of a Corvette hatch roof leaking before, lol. I think they were tested to make sure they leaked at least the minimum amount from the factory. It. Was not a teriffic design. But weather stripping and adjusting will help. I think the AIM manual has some adjustment procedures.
Actually, my factory weatherstripping on my '76 was great even at 35 years old. It wasn't until I replaced it that I had trouble. I believe the best weatherstripping you can get now is from Willcox Corvette. They have installation tips also. It's all in the install and adjustment.
Before you buy weatherstrip, take the time to readjust the tops. Follow the factory manual. To the T! Get them adjusted correctly with the headliners removed so you can get a light in there and make certain there on tight. In ALL places.
read the factory manual!
Mine leaked for years, thought it was normal. read the instructions, redid them, no leaks!
